Temperature control: Tips for keeping it below 4°C
The refrigerator temperature should always be kept below 4°C (40°F) to ensure that food is stored safely. You can use a thermometer to measure the temperature in the refrigerator to control the temperature. Check the temperature regularly to make sure that the refrigerator is at the appropriate temperature to prevent food spoilage and maintain long-lasting freshness.

Refrigerator cleaning method
The importance of regular cleaning
It is very important to keep your refrigerator clean regularly. This not only removes food odors, but also helps prevent the growth of bacteria and mold. A dirty refrigerator can jeopardize food safety and reduce the nutritional value of food. By cleaning it regularly, you can increase the performance of your refrigerator, which helps keep food fresh and also keeps your kitchen environment healthy.
How to properly clean the refrigerator
To clean the refrigerator, first empty it completely and put all the food in a safe place. Then, use mild soap and warm water to clean the exterior and interior of the refrigerator. Avoid using harsh chemical cleaners, as they can damage the refrigerator’s materials. Use a soft sponge or cloth to clean the various surfaces or shelves inside the refrigerator. Finally, dry the refrigerator thoroughly and turn it back on. Following this cleaning process regularly will keep the refrigerator functioning properly for a long time.
